Hettinger County, North Dakota

Hettinger County has 64 bridges in the National Bridge Inventory, with 9 rated poor and 10 rated scour-critical. Its poor-condition share of 14.1% is above the 11.1% statewide average. Poor-condition bridges carry about 176 daily vehicle crossings.

Important safety note

Poor condition does not mean a bridge is unsafe. It means at least one major component has significant deterioration and the bridge is a priority for maintenance, repair, or replacement. Bridges judged unsafe are closed or restricted by transportation agencies.
